草庐IT

R ggplot2 轴标题麻烦

全部标签

windows - 更改 Windows 可执行文件的标题栏

我正在创建一个类似Resourcehacker的应用程序。我想更改窗口的标题栏文本,我可以使用SPY++找到其句柄。有什么方法可以修改程序集的资源并通过我的代码更改标题,以便更改是永久性的。是否有像我的程序一样免费或商业化的工具?它可以更改Windows可执行文件的标题栏文本并将其组装回去。我乐于接受建议。我正在使用VC++编写我的应用程序。 最佳答案 我的浏览器目前在其标题栏中有“更改Windows可执行文件的标题栏-StackOVerflow-Opera”。请说明如何通过资源解决该问题。现在,这实际上是可能的,但不是通过资源。您

c++ - Unicode 麻烦了! Ms-Access 97 迁移到 Ms-Access 2007

问题分为两步:问题步骤1。访问包含以UTF-8编码的XML字符串的97数据库。问题归结为:Access97数据库包含以UTF-8编码的XML字符串。所以我创建了一个补丁工具,用于将XML字符串从UTF-8单独转换为Unicode。为了将UTF8字符串转换为Unicode,我使用了函数MultiByteToWideChar(CP_UTF8,0,PChar(OriginalName),-1,@newName,Size);.(其中newName是声明为“newName:Array[0..2048]ofWideChar;").此功能在大多数情况下都适用,我已经用Spainsh、Arabic和字

.net - Threading.Timer的麻烦

我正在使用Threading.Timer,例如:newSystem.Threading.Timer(newSystem.Threading.TimerCallback(x=>file.Write(DateTime.Now.ToString())),null,0,600000);例如,它从11:00:00开始,然后我进入文件:11:00:0011:10:0011:20:00...12:10:0012:19:5912:29:59为什么?从某个时间开始做这样的事情?我试过其他定时器,像Timers.Timer,和winformsTimer,情况一样。这让我很沮丧。编辑:在线程中发布的带有准确

python - 使用进程名称获取另一个程序的窗口标题

这个问题可能很基础,但我很难破解它。我假设我将不得不在ctypes.windll.user32中使用一些东西。请记住,我几乎没有使用这些库甚至整个ctypes的经验。我已经使用这段代码列出了所有的窗口标题,但我不知道应该如何更改这段代码以获得带有进程名称的窗口标题:importctypesEnumWindows=ctypes.windll.user32.EnumWindowsEnumWindowsProc=ctypes.WINFUNCTYPE(ctypes.c_bool,ctypes.POINTER(ctypes.c_int),ctypes.POINTER(ctypes.c_int))

windows - AppleScript 获取窗口的标题

我尝试获取应用程序的标题(并将其复制为var)到目前为止,这是我的代码,但这是失败的tellapplication"app"activateendtelltellapplication"SystemEvents"setfrontApptonameoffirstapplicationprocesswhosefrontmostistrueendtelltellapplicationfrontAppifthe(countofwindows)isnot0thensetwindow_nametonameoffrontwindowendifendtell结果:error"appgotanerror

c++ - 麻烦重启exe

我需要在下载更新后重新启动我正在处理的程序,除非我遇到了一些问题。如果我使用CreateProcess,什么也不会发生,如果我使用ShellExecute,我会收到0xC0150002错误,如果我将ShellExecute与命令“runas”一起使用,它工作正常。我可以使用CreateProcess和ShellExecute启动命令提示符,只是再次使用不同的exe,并且不想使用runas,因为这会提升exe。有什么想法吗?Windows7、visualstudio2008c++alttexthttp://lodle.net/shell_error.jpg创建进程:charexePath

WPF 从子项设置窗口标题

如果我在Window中托管了一个UserControl,如下所示:如何从UserControl设置Window.Title?另一个要求是UserControl可以从静态resx文件中提取和设置窗口标题,例如{x:Staticp:Resources.MyViewTitle}编辑经过更多研究,我认为附加属性可能是答案。我该如何实现一个Window.Title属性,我可以将它放在任何子UserControl上,从而允许我设置Window标题? 最佳答案 (未测试):使用VisualTreeHelper.GetParent向上遍历可视化树,

python - Cmake 在 Windows 上使用 python 遇到麻烦

我尝试在Windows上使用cmake构建C++项目。但是我发现了一个错误:CMakeErroratC:/ProgramFiles(x86)/CMake/share/cmake-3.3/Modules/FindPackageHandleStandardArgs.cmake:148(message):CouldNOTfindPythonLibs(missing:PYTHON_LIBRARIES)(foundsuitableversion"3.4.1",minimumrequiredis"3.4")CallStack(mostrecentcallfirst):C:/ProgramFiles

windows - 将批处理标题设置为文件名

有没有办法让批处理文件的标题与批处理文件的文件名相同?我经常重命名文件,所以让批处理文件的标题与文件名相同会阻止我不断更改标题名称。 最佳答案 我想你可以通过像这样写一行代码来做到这一点。title%~n0%0是批处理文件的文件路径,~n删除路径并保留名称。希望它有用。 关于windows-将批处理标题设置为文件名,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/33590072/

c# - 从 Windows 服务获取窗口标题

我的公司正在使用一个不幸的第三方产品,该产品要求用户登录到运行其产品的两个实例的XP工作站。我正在尝试使用this...从Windows服务中获取每个打开的窗口的标题以进行监视,但它们始终返回null或空。但是,我可以获得进程名称,就好了。我对标题而不是进程名称感兴趣的原因是进程名称相同(同一应用程序的两个实例)但标题是唯一的。对于任何打开的窗口,例如记事本的打开实例,我也会得到相同的结果。该服务作为运行第三方应用程序的两个实例的用户运行。所以我很好奇,为什么我能够获得进程名称,而不是标题?出于某种原因是否需要指定SERVICE_INTERACTIVE_PROCESS才能看到标题,而不